What they do

An Electrician works on electrical systems in buildings. Installs electrical wiring and lighting in new construction, and repairs or upgrade wiring, outlets or other parts of older electrical systems. Checks safety and makes installations or repairs that are in compliance with local building codes. May also specialize in electrical work required in different manufacturing industries, electrical systems for cars, plane or boats, or electrical and lighting work in the film industry.

Job Description

Job Responsibilities Install, maintain, and repair all electrical systems. Inclusive of conduit, wiring, breakers, motors, electrical lighting, battery lighting, outlets, and electrical equipment. Power distribution and generation. Alarm and communication systems. Monitor and inspect work to insure compliance with work specifications, codes and regulations. Must be able to perform a variety of general maintenance repairs including but not limited to general repair work in the hospital and off-site facilities. Plan installations by reading blueprints and schematics. Keep work areas orderly, clean, and safe. Maintain adequate inventory of electrical supplies, tools, and parts. Coordinate work order lists with Engineering Supervisor. Coordinate with Construction Supervisor for scheduling and completion of in house construction projects. Timely input data and time into the maintenance work order system. Compliance with all Riverview Health and Engineering Department policies and procedures. Availability to assist Engineering staff by telephone or call-in. Other duties as assigned.
